Splitter 3 PCs, two users

Discussion in 'KVM' started by Abe, Feb 8, 2021.

  1. Abe

    Abe New member

    I have 3 PCs in the following setup:

    PC #1
    =====
    1x keyboard
    1x mouse
    1x monitor
    Used by user #1

    PC #2
    =====
    1x keyboard
    1x mouse
    1x monitor
    Used by user #2

    PC #3
    =====
    2x monitors (one at User #1 location; one at User #2 location)
    Should be controlled (keyboard/mouse only) by either user #1 or user #2 - one user at a time

    User #1 should be able to switch control of PC #1 and PC #3 through their own one keyboard/mouse.
    User #2 should be able to switch control of PC #2 and PC #3 through their own one keyboard/mouse.

    Can you offer a solution to accomplish this?

    To accomplish this you will need a combination of a KVM splitter (Reverse KVM) and 2x KVM switches.

    CS261 KVM splitter will get connected to PC #3, allowing PC #3 to be controlled by user #1 and user #2 - one at a time.

    2x 2-port CS72D KVM switches will each serve each of the two users, allowing the user to switch between his/her own computer (port #1) and PC #3 (port #2 connected to one of the ports on CS261).
